Output 508f34a42aa42d342ffd6ada04b942617f2472fee7beb26a0ae10a579721a33a:0

value
968045340
script pubkey
OP_0 OP_PUSHBYTES_20 6821b3ea6b49aeeb07653a18670a909e94b88efa
address
bc1qdqsm86ntfxhwkpm98gvxwz5sn62t3rh6whww5v
transaction
508f34a42aa42d342ffd6ada04b942617f2472fee7beb26a0ae10a579721a33a
confirmations
111776
spent
true